Civil servants form the backbone of governance in the country. They shape policies, drive reforms and help build a better India.
Celebrating their tireless efforts and contributions in empowering people and ensuring that we have a good life, the government of India celebrates 21st of April every year as National Civil Services Day.
It was on this day back in 1947 that Sardar Vallabhbhai Patel, the first Home Minister of Independent India, addressed the probationary officers of Administrative Services at Metcalf House in Delhi. In an inspiring speech, Sardar Patel referred to the civil servants as ‘the steel frame of India,’ thereby serving as a reminder to reflect on their services and reaffirm their commitment to serving citizens.
